提高海上单道反射地震记录信噪比和分辨率的方法技术

摘    要:海上浅层单道反射地震的数据不需要水平叠加处理,该方法在更容易获得较好的保真度、较高分辨率剖面的同时,要求有高信噪比的地震记录为基础。通过对野外数据采集过程中噪声干扰情况的分析,合理地选择激发震源、检波器因素及仪器参数,不仅能够得到频带较宽、主频较高的高分辨率地震时间剖面,而且能够压制部分随机噪声;在资料处理流程中,采用有效的方法技术对数据进行信噪分离,削弱多次及绕射等干扰波的影响,可进一步提高单道地震记录的信噪比和分辨率。

THE TECHNIQUE OF IMPROVING SIGNAL-TO-NOISE RATIO AND RESOLUTION FOR MARINE SEISMIC PROFILING

Abstract:The records of marine seismic profiling, with non-stacking needed and easy to get having high fidelity and resolution, must be of high signal-to-noise ratio. Based on the analyses of interferences encountered during field data acquisition, by reasonably selecting factors of source and geophone and recording parameters, not only seismic records of wider frequency band and higher dominant frequency could be obtained, but also some random interference could be impressed. The signal-to-noise ratio of marine seismic profiling could be further improved by adopting effective separation technique of signal/noise in data processing, as well as suppressing multiple-reflections and refractions.
